Description: ISS provides after-school programs in five New York City public schools: PS 2 at 122 Henry Street, PS 34 at 730 E. 12th Street, PS 42 at 71 Hester Street, PS 126 at 80 Catherine Street and PS 130 at 143 Baxter Street. ACS/HRA accepted and USDA approved means are served. Our database was created for an after school program based in New York City for minority elementary schoolers. Being that everything was on paper, we decided to make a database to not only have all our data filed and stored securely but also to give us a clear view on whether the students are improving in their academics, whether we have the right tutors for each class, and how we can improve on our teaching methods.
